Windows: Desktop Icons Became Black/Corrupted


Problem:
Recently I noticed some icons on my desktop became black/corrupted. I tried pressing F5, killing explorer.exe, and rebooting the computer...but still no luck.


Solution:
You may want to capture a screenshot to save the icons position before proceeding, as Windows may rearrange your icons in the following steps.

1. Right-click on the desktop, select Properties
2. In Display Properties, select Appearance -> Effects...
3. Check "Use large icons"
4. Click OK, and Apply the settings
5. The screen should refresh and the icons should change back to normal
6. Now go back and un-check "Use large icons"


Alternative Solutions:
1. Browse to:
C:\Documents and Settings\username\Local Settings\Application Data

2. Delete IconCache.db
Note: If you do not see the file, click Tools -> Folder Options, and make sure "Show hidden files and folders" is selected

3. Reboot your pc
